**Ticket: Drift in ValidatorHub plugin settings**

We have observed that the ValidatorHub plugin system, which loads third-party data validators at runtime, is running with settings that differ between the two production nodes. Support should advise affected customers that validation results may be inconsistent until reconciliation completes. For reference during tickets, the canonical configuration is reproduced below.

service settings:
PRAIX_LOG_LEVEL=error
PRAIX_METRICS_HOST=metrics.praix.qorvelcorp.corp
PRAIX_POOL_SIZE=16

**Handover: Currency Rounding — Marit to Osk**

For the Tollgate release: the conversion service still rounds half-up before summing line items, causing one-cent drift on multi-item invoices. Fix is staged behind the `bankers-round` flag; enable it only after reconciliation passes. The staging vault holding test ledgers unlocks with the passphrase below.

vault phrase of bagaf-kajeg = jorath-feniel-briir-siliel-ralix

Ticket: Config drift in TerraNote offline mode

During the Ridgemoor pilot, several field tablets running TerraNote cached stale sync intervals after switching to offline mode, diverging from what the provisioning service pushed. Surveyors saw duplicate plot records on reconnect. Before we cut the 4.2 release, we should pin these values in the release manifest. For reference, the values currently live on the fleet are as follows.

config for kafof-bawef:
holath:
  log_level: debug
  metrics_host: metrics.holath.qorvelsys.internal
  pin: 2191
  pool_size: 32